What did we learn last time? ü Choose safe routes ü Use crossings if you can ü If there’s no crossing, find somewhere safe – away from parked cars and bends in the road ü Stay focussed – never cross while using a mobile or stereo ü Don’t trust traffic ü Use the Green Cross Code

Your personal checklist 1. 2. 3. 4. 5. 6. 7. Money, including some for emergencies A phone card or mobile phone Let someone know who you are with Let someone know where you are going Work out how to get there Arrange a time to be home List of telephone numbers in case you need to ring someone 8. A plan in case something goes wrong

You have missed the bus home Is there another bus I can catch? Can I go back into school and phone someone?

One of your friends asks for a lift on your bike • Best not to risk it! • How good are you at negotiating or saying no?

Two of your friends are fighting on the bus • If you can’t calm the situation down – keep out of the way. • Let the driver know that there is a problem • If things are getting out of hand it may be safer for the bus to be stopped

Need to phone but no money • Make sure you know how to make a reverse charge call • Dial 100 and ask for the operator to connect them to the telephone number that they need • On mobile phones there is the option of dialling 0800 ‘reverse’

Practice, practice! • It is a really good idea to practice your journey to your secondary school during the summer holidays. • Plan your route and walk it with your parents • Work out where it is safe to cross the road • Think about …. . • www. travelinesoutheast. org. uk
